MSP430F123IDW-MSP430F123IDWR-MSP430F123IPW-MSP430F123IPWR-MSP430F123IRHBR-MSP430F123IRHBT
16-Bit Ultra-Low-Power Microcontroller, 8kB ROM, 256B RAM, USART, Comparator
MSP430x12x
MIXED SIGNAL MICROCONTROLLER
SLAS312C − JULY 2001 − REVISED SEPTEMBER 2004 Low Supply Voltage Range 1.8 V to 3.6 V Ultralow-Power Consumption:
− Active Mode: 200 μA at 1 MHz, 2.2 V
− Standby Mode: 0.7 μA
− Off Mode (RAM Retention): 0.1 μA
Five Power Saving Modes Wake-Up From Standby Mode in less
than 6 μs
16-Bit RISC Architecture, 125 ns
Instruction Cycle Time
Basic Clock Module Configurations:
− Various Internal Resistors
− Single External Resistor
− 32 kHz Crystal
− High Frequency Crystal
− Resonator
− External Clock Source
16-Bit Timer_A With Three
Capture/Compare Registers
On-Chip Comparator for Analog Signal
Compare Function or Slope A/D
Conversion
Serial Communication Interface (USART0)
Software-Selects Asynchronous UART or
Synchronous SPI
Serial Onboard Programming,
No External Programming Voltage Needed
Programmable Code Protection by Security
Fuse
Family Members Include:
MSP430F122: 4KB + 256B Flash Memory
256B RAM
MSP430F123: 8KB + 256B Flash Memory
256B RAM
Available in a 28-Pin Plastic Small-Outline
Wide Body (SOWB) Package, 28-Pin Plastic
Thin Shrink Small-Outline Package
(TSSOP) and 32-Pin QFN Package
For Complete Module Descriptions, See the
MSP430x1xx Family User’s Guide,
Literature Number SLAU049


description

The Texas Instruments MSP430 family of ultralow power microcontrollers consist of several devices featuring
different sets of peripherals targeted for various applications. The architecture, combined with five low power
modes is optimized to achieve extended battery life in portable measurement applications. The device features
a powerful 16-bit RISC CPU, 16-bit registers, and constant generators that attribute to maximum code efficiency.
The digitally controlled oscillator (DCO) allows wake-up from low-power modes to active mode in less than 6μs.
The MSP430F12x series is an ultralow-power mixed signal microcontroller with a built-in 16-bit timer and
twenty-two I/O pins. The MSP430F12x series also has a built-in communication capability using asynchronous
(UART) and synchronous (SPI) protocols in addition to a versatile analog comparator.
Typical applications include sensor systems that capture analog signals, convert them to digital values, and then
process the data and display them or transmit them to a host system. Stand alone RF sensor front end is another
area of application. The I/O port inputs provide single slope A/D conversion capability on resistive sensors.
